Tinpear positions itself as “The AI Launchpad,” offering individuals and businesses AI learning, certification, news and insights, product reviews, prototype development, and custom AI solutions. It is not a single chatbot tool, but more of an integrated service platform combining “AI education + enterprise consulting + application development and integration,” covering the path from beginner-level learning to enterprise-grade deployment.
In terms of AI capabilities, Tinpear says it can build LLM applications, Copilots, RAG-based knowledge retrieval, automated Agents, NLP, visual classification, prediction, recommendation, and analytics assistants, with support from prototype validation through to production deployment and operations. Its enterprise services include AI Strategy, Automation & Agents, Custom Solutions, Integrations, Training & Enablement, and Security & MLOps. Typical integrations include Salesforce, HubSpot, Zendesk, Slack, Microsoft 365, Google Workspace, Notion, Confluence, ServiceNow, Shopify, Zapier, Make, Twilio, WhatsApp Business, PostgreSQL, and BigQuery.
The crawled text does not disclose specific pricing, plans, free quotas, or trial policies. It also does not clarify whether course certifications are paid or whether Tinpear Labs is quoted on a per-project basis. Before procurement, buyers should contact the official team to confirm the delivery scope, service period, maintenance fees, model usage costs, and training fees.
The main advantage is its end-to-end coverage: it can serve AI beginners while also providing enterprises with roadmaps, rapid PoCs, system integration, MLOps, and training. Its industry use cases are fairly broad, covering education, healthcare, finance, customer service operations, retail, and e-commerce. The limitation is insufficient transparency around key information: it does not specify the underlying models, Chinese-language support, detailed privacy terms, compliance certifications, or publicly verifiable case studies. The efficiency improvement figures in its marketing materials also lack sample context and should be treated with caution.
Tinpear is suitable for individuals who want to learn AI systematically, teams planning internal AI training, and companies that lack in-house AI engineering capabilities but want to quickly validate scenarios such as customer service Copilots, knowledge bases, workflow automation, and recommendation systems. If a company already has a mature AI platform and engineering team, Tinpear is better suited as a supplement for consulting, PoC work, or training.
Access from mainland China, payment methods, and the Chinese-language experience are not specified in the text, so china_access is currently rated as unknown. If localization, Chinese-language corpora, and domestic network availability are priorities, consider comparing it with Dify, FastGPT, Coze, Alibaba Cloud Bailian, Baidu Qianfan, and Tencent Hunyuan. If international courses and enterprise automation are more important, alternatives to compare include Coursera, DeepLearning.AI, Zapier AI, Make, and LangChain/LangSmith.
